An example usage is as follows: The editor is used to provide ref to a RichEditor component. This is a demo of the react-rte editor. npm install react-native-richtext-editor --save. A Flexible Rich Text Editor for React Native. React Rich Text Editor. Every element in the editor is rendered the same way as a react functional component: // Define a React component renderer for our code blocks. This module was specifically made for Contentful's rich text feature. The component takes two necessary props: editor and onChange. Usage. The onChange prop can be used to grab the stylized text. You can use it freely for your personal or commercial projects. All you have to do is specify what build you're using in the editor prop, in this example it's editor= {ClassicEditor}. React Rich Text Editor Example. @ckeditor /ckeditor5-build-classic. Install. Lets go ahead and start integrating the CKEditor in our example application.

This library currently supports iOS only. First, lets create a React app: $ npx create-react-app quill-editor $ cd quill-editor $ npm start. Our text editor will be able to add different headers, provide different colors to the texts, add subscript and superscript, indent or un-indent the text, and many more. The Angular Rich Text Editor component is a feature-rich, WYSIWYG HTML and Markdown editor that provides the best user interface for editing content. React Quill 4,931. Building an awesome editor for your React-based web application is by no means easy. Its purpose is nothing more than to help me practice using TypeScript and React together while getting a better understanding of user-text interactions. A rich text editors aim is to reduce the effort for users trying to express their formatting as valid HTML markup. Currently, there are many Rich Text Editors available for ReactJS. You can change the theme of the editor from a list of available themes. Example of API in React Rich Text Editor Component. Install the Quill component for ReactJS. If you want to use this library and reduce its bundle size, you can do that using a Babel plugin that allows you to optionally require modules. Next we create our model and migration by running this: npx sequelize-cli model:create --name Document --attributes name:string,document:text,pdfPath:string. @coreui/coreui-pro-react-admin-template CoreUI Pro React Admin Template. Text editors differ from Word processors, such as Microsoft Word or WordPerfect, in that they do not add additional formatting information to documents. React-quill is a Quill component for use with React and React-based frameworks ( like Next.js). The editor is WYSIWYG and includes formatting tools whilst retaining the ability to write markdown shortcuts inline and output plain Markdown.